What does 'no quarter' mean?

It means "No mercy". It usually means that you will not allow a defeated enemy to live. "We ask no quarter, we give no quarter"...we don't ask for your mercy if you defeat us, and you can expect death from us if we defeat you.


What is the highest vauled quarter?

The highest known sale price for a US quarter was $550,000.00 in May of 1990 for a 1901-S Barber quarter graded MS-68 by NGC.

How do you tell a s quarter from a quarter?

If it is a "s" quarter it will always have the S mintmark. You can find this mintmark usually on the back of the coin. The exact location will depend on the type of quarter.
